Founded in 2015 by Nikolay Storonsky and Vlad Yatsenko in London, Revolut launched as a prepaid card with no foreign transaction fees — a simple but powerful idea for frequent travelers. It rapidly expanded into a full financial superapp offering bank accounts, crypto trading, stock investing, savings vaults, insurance, and international money transfers. Revolut now serves over 45 million personal customers and 500,000 business clients across 38 countries. In 2024, it finally obtained a UK banking license after years of regulatory challenges. The company is valued at $45 billion, making it the most valuable startup in Europe and one of the most valuable private fintech companies in the world.

Nikolay Storonsky

Founder / CEO

Nikolay Storonsky is the co-founder and CEO of Revolut. Born in Russia, he studied physics at Moscow Institute of Physics and Technology before moving to London to work as a derivatives trader at Credit Suisse and Lehman Brothers. Frustrated with high foreign exchange fees while traveling, he co-founded Revolut to offer fee-free international spending. Known for his relentless drive, Nikolay has grown Revolut into Europe's most valuable startup at a $45 billion valuation.

Vlad Yatsenko

Co-Founder / CTO

Vlad Yatsenko is the co-founder and CTO of Revolut. A highly skilled software engineer originally from Ukraine, he previously worked at Deutsche Bank and Credit Suisse alongside Nikolay. Vlad built much of Revolut's core technical infrastructure and has been responsible for scaling the platform to handle millions of transactions daily across dozens of countries and currencies with the reliability expected of a banking product.
